From b408166a145ac44b4f91fa7e4715e7f4adf23858 Mon Sep 17 00:00:00 2001 From: Mateusz <2871798+orhtej2@users.noreply.github.com> Date: Mon, 25 Dec 2023 23:57:13 +0100 Subject: [PATCH 1/5] Added threads and yt music as platforms --- conf/sql/1.7.3.sql | 3 +++ 1 file changed, 3 insertions(+) create mode 100644 conf/sql/1.7.3.sql diff --git a/conf/sql/1.7.3.sql b/conf/sql/1.7.3.sql new file mode 100644 index 0000000..1f9caba --- /dev/null +++ b/conf/sql/1.7.3.sql @@ -0,0 +1,3 @@ +INSERT INTO `cp_platforms` (`slug`, `type`, `label`, `home_url`, `submit_url`) VALUES +('threads', 'social', 'Threads', 'https://www.threads.net/', 'https://www.threads.net/login'), +('youtube-music', 'podcasting', 'YouTube Music', 'https://www.youtube.com/creators/podcasts/', 'https://studio.youtube.com/channel/content/podcasts'); From 89e25a23b696c55a739971dee1c868338387d653 Mon Sep 17 00:00:00 2001 From: Mateusz <2871798+orhtej2@users.noreply.github.com> Date: Mon, 25 Dec 2023 23:57:28 +0100 Subject: [PATCH 2/5] Rename 1.7.3.sql to v1.7.3.sql --- conf/sql/{1.7.3.sql => v1.7.3.sql} | 0 1 file changed, 0 insertions(+), 0 deletions(-) rename conf/sql/{1.7.3.sql => v1.7.3.sql} (100%) diff --git a/conf/sql/1.7.3.sql b/conf/sql/v1.7.3.sql similarity index 100% rename from conf/sql/1.7.3.sql rename to conf/sql/v1.7.3.sql From a35e78d7c92fc9053b50a5f5ad5178dd36097906 Mon Sep 17 00:00:00 2001 From: Mateusz <2871798+orhtej2@users.noreply.github.com> Date: Tue, 26 Dec 2023 00:02:49 +0100 Subject: [PATCH 3/5] Upgrade to 1.7.3 --- manifest.toml |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/manifest.toml b/manifest.toml index ff548cc..0975a37 100644 --- a/manifest.toml +++ b/manifest.toml @@ -5,9 +5,9 @@ name = "Castopod" description.en = "Hosting platform made for podcasters" description.fr = "Plateforme d'hébergement conçue pour les podcasteurs" -version = "1.7.2~ynh1" +version = "1.7.3~ynh1" -maintainers = ["eric_G"] +maintainers = ["orhtej2"] [upstream] license = "GPL-3.0-only" @@ -42,8 +42,8 @@ ram.runtime = "50M" [resources.sources] [resources.sources.main] - url = "https://code.castopod.org/adaures/castopod/uploads/90fa3ed05c3cd11c99411da6f41c4960/castopod-1.7.2.zip" - sha256 = "cfa886e3f70a54bdd94a99d39f41f86f04ecfafacfae29de674f384dd183de05" + url = "https://code.castopod.org/adaures/castopod/uploads/0e6380add18cd9e976d009bdd596a080/castopod-1.7.3.zip" + sha256 = "596340efa09b48f82864cb8f9fd94627b8927d3c4c9833a249fc4dd0f1f48d6c" in_subdir = true [resources.system_user] From 8df6c4b1f61d70bceaa2901605edc7c5cf83e0e3 Mon Sep 17 00:00:00 2001 From: yunohost-bot Date: Mon, 25 Dec 2023 23:02:52 +0000 Subject: [PATCH 4/5] Auto-update README --- README.md | 2 +- README_fr.md |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/README.md b/README.md index 9742bdc..201d4cc 100755 --- a/README.md +++ b/README.md @@ -32,7 +32,7 @@ Castopod is easy to install and was built on top of CodeIgniter4, a powerful PHP - Multi-tenant: host as many podcasts as you want - Multi-user: add contributors and set roles -**Shipped version:** 1.7.2~ynh1 +**Shipped version:** 1.7.3~ynh1 **Demo:** https://podcast.podlibre.org/@podlibre_fr diff --git a/README_fr.md b/README_fr.md index 4444016..283b795 100755 --- a/README_fr.md +++ b/README_fr.md @@ -31,7 +31,7 @@ Castopod est une plate-forme d'hébergement gratuite et open source conçue pour - Multi-locataire : hébergez autant de podcasts que vous le souhaitez - Multi-utilisateur : ajouter des contributeurs et définir des rôles -**Version incluse :** 1.7.2~ynh1 +**Version incluse :** 1.7.3~ynh1 **Démo :** https://podcast.podlibre.org/@podlibre_fr From 481e094e31ce82f2cc7cf0db416bd0784a830c87 Mon Sep 17 00:00:00 2001 From: Mateusz <2871798+orhtej2@users.noreply.github.com> Date: Tue, 26 Dec 2023 00:15:47 +0100 Subject: [PATCH 5/5] Run new SQL migrations. --- scripts/upgrade |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/scripts/upgrade b/scripts/upgrade index c7d163a..de8add8 100755 --- a/scripts/upgrade +++ b/scripts/upgrade @@ -124,6 +124,10 @@ if ynh_compare_current_package_version --comparison le --version "1.6.5~ynh1"; t # cf https://code.castopod.org/adaures/castopod/-/releases/v1.6.1 ynh_mysql_connect_as --user=$db_user --password=$db_pwd --database=$db_name < "../conf/sql/v1.6.1.sql" fi +if ynh_compare_current_package_version --comparison le --version "1.7.3~ynh1"; then + # cf https://code.castopod.org/adaures/castopod/-/releases/v1.7.3 + ynh_mysql_connect_as --user=$db_user --password=$db_pwd --database=$db_name < "../conf/sql/v1.7.3.sql" +fi #================================================= # END OF SCRIPT